What’s the difference in treatment for a parathyroid adenoma and a parathyroid hyperplasia? In this video, Dr. Babak Larian will discuss the differences and his treatment approach for both conditions.
Dr. Babak Larian is renowned for his expertise in parathyroid surgery.
